My property sits up higher than the rest of the neighborhood. It gives us a lot of privacy, but it also gives us a lot of wind out of the west in the winter. You can actually feel the wind sometimes when it is really gusty. I have about 6ft x 60ft of space behind the fence along the alley. What can I plant there to create a good wind break that won't empty out my wallet? I have to be careful of the power line that runs along the fence. I would love something that requires minimal trimming/pruning and possibly looks good or flowers. I think an evergreen may work best, but I am having trouble finding any ideas.
Some possibilities:
azalea
weigela
arborvitae
Any suggestions?
